The History of Saunas: A Journey Through Time

Origins of Sauna Culture

Saunas date back thousands of years, originating in Finland where they were used for both bathing and socializing. The warmth of the steam helped cleanse the body and relax the mind, serving as more than just a space for hygiene.

Evolution of Saunas Over Time

From ancient Roman baths to modern-day spas, saunas have evolved significantly. The introduction of various heating methods—like electric and wood-burning systems—has diversified options available today.

Types of Saunas: Finding Your Perfect Fit

Traditional Saunas: Embracing Authenticity

Traditional saunas are often constructed from wood and use a wood-burning sauna heater or electric sauna heater to create steam. The experience is rooted in history and offers an authentic feel.

Infrared Saunas: Technology Meets Wellness

Infrared saunas utilize infrared panels instead of traditional heating methods. They penetrate deeper into the skin, providing unique health benefits while operating at lower temperatures.

Outdoor Saunas: Bringing Nature Indoors

If you're looking for tranquility under the sky, outdoor saunas are an excellent choice. They combine nature with relaxation, making them popular among wellness enthusiasts.

Hybrid Saunas: The Best of Both Worlds

Hybrid saunas incorporate elements from both traditional and infrared styles. They allow users to enjoy varying heat levels and therapeutic benefits.

Sauna Heaters Explained: Choosing the Right One for Your Needs

Electric Sauna Heaters: Convenience at Its Finest

Electric heaters are user-friendly and heat up quickly. They’re perfect for those who prioritize ease of use over traditional practices.

Wood-Burning Sauna Heaters: A Touch of Tradition

For purists who love the scent and ambiance of burning wood, these heaters provide an unmatched experience that transports you back in time.

Is It Worth It? Evaluating Costs vs Benefits

Initial Investment vs Long-Term Gains

While purchasing any type of sauna—from outdoor saunas to home saunas—requires upfront costs, consider it an investment in long-term health benefits like reduced healthcare costs down the line.

| Type | Average Cost | Health Benefits | |-----------------|----------------|----------------------------------------------------------| | Traditional | $3,000 - $6,000 | Stress relief, detoxification | | Infrared | $1,500 - $4,000 | Pain relief, improved circulation | | Outdoor | $4,000 - $10,000| Immersion in nature + all previous benefits |

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What’s the best type of home sauna?
    The best home sauna depends on individual preferences; traditional saunas offer authenticity while infrared options provide deeper tissue penetration.
How often should I use my home sauna?
    Most experts recommend using it 2-3 times per week for optimal health benefits.
Can I install my own outdoor sauna?
    Yes! Kits are available that make installation easy even if you’re not particularly handy.
Are there any risks associated with using a sauna?
    Generally safe; however, individuals with cardiovascular issues should consult their doctor before use.
How do I maintain my wooden sauna?
    Regularly clean surfaces with mild soap; avoid harsh chemicals that may damage wood integrity.
Is it better to use an electric or wood-burning heater?
    It largely depends on personal preference; electric heaters are convenient while wood-burning offers traditional ambiance.
